Output c94622cb83305d5c2aa506a9f83f8ff17ace1ed7339cb736c928ad048992619a:3

value
107577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d71ce060f6278d7acf1b7706ec9644c63599268 OP_EQUAL
address
35qJfUGDw734PzB2DWdDX1wrgKKYaxZ9VH
transaction
c94622cb83305d5c2aa506a9f83f8ff17ace1ed7339cb736c928ad048992619a
spent
true